Cellular component Trans-Golgi network The network of interconnected tubular and cisternal structures located within the Golgi apparatus on the side distal to the endoplasmic reticulum, from which secretory vesicles emerge. The trans-Golgi network is important in the later stages of protein secretion where it is thought to play a key role in the sorting and targeting of secreted proteins to the correct destination.
Biological process Intracellular cholesterol transport The directed movement of cholesterol, cholest-5-en-3-beta-ol, within cells.
